Jobs for Philosophy & Religion Grads in Alabama
In this state, there are 220 people employed in jobs related to a philosophy & religion degree, compared to 23,100 nationwide.

Wages for Philosophy & Religion Jobs in Alabama
In this state, philosophy & religion grads earn an average of $63,930. Nationwide, they make an average of $82,420.
